    CVE-2025-3643 – Moodle Reflected Cross-site Scripting Vulnerability

    April 25, 2025

    CVE ID : CVE-2025-3643

    Published : April 25, 2025, 3:15 p.m. | 3 hours, 46 minutes ago

    Description : A flaw was found in Moodle. The return URL in the policy tool required additional sanitizing to prevent a reflected Cross-site scripting (XSS) risk.

    Severity: 5.4 | MEDIUM

    CVE-2025-6994 – Smartdatasoft WordPress Reveal Listing Plugin Privilege Escalation

    August 6, 2025

    CVE ID : CVE-2025-6994

    Published : Aug. 6, 2025, 4:16 a.m. | 19 hours, 28 minutes ago

    Description : The Reveal Listing plugin by smartdatasoft for WordPress is vulnerable to privilege escalation in versions up to, and including, 3.3. This is due to the plugin allowing users who are registering new accounts to set their own role or by supplying ‘listing_user_role’ field. This makes it possible for unauthenticated attackers to gain elevated privileges by creating an account with the administrator role.

    Severity: 9.8 | CRITICAL
